Signal box and railway bridge viewed from the south, Pontrilas

Image: © Jaggery Taken: 6 Sep 2011

The top of the signal box can be seen behind railings. The opposite view http://www.geograph.org.uk/photo/2589127 shows the side of the signal box. The bridge carries the Welsh Marches railway lines.
